I have a 4 year old Carrier 38CKS A/C Unit. A couple days ago, my A/C stopped cooling. I went outside and noticed the fan wasn't turning. I hear noise like the compressor is running, but the fan motor appeares to be fried. I reset the breakers and that didn't help. I shutoff the A/C unit. Also, I checked the furnace filter as well and it was clean.

I have a service appt today. The condensor and compressor parts are warranted 5 years, so I'm within the warranty period.

My questions are...

1) Do you think my problem is covered? I think this fan motor is considered part of the condensor? I know I still have to pay for the service call and labor.

2) Also, do you think when the fan motor failed, would that damage the compressor as well?
